Transaction cc91f2de96f8fbb8ec4847080e3622ec76a9b72474681405fed2b3e91c80cd71

2 Input
1 Outputs
  • cc91f2de96f8fbb8ec4847080e3622ec76a9b72474681405fed2b3e91c80cd71:0
  • value  529863
    address  1CgTQ7RSqW51pzpbQ8Ws94twHzrkrrwG9H